Last Friday’s fish fry at the Wake
Forest Fire Department raised about
$12,000, Fire Chief David Williams Jr.
said this week. The event was well
attended, and the firemen sold about 300
more plates than last year.
In other news, Williams said
the only call the department had during
Saturday’s thunderstorms was for what
was reported as a house fire but was
just a lightning strike. “Honestly, I
think every other department in the
county had something.”
The storms reduced the risk
of brush fires.
As for the cause of the
March 22 fire at 7516 Welcome Drive in
Waterfall Plantation on Thompson Mill
Road, Williams said he has heard little.
“They got some preliminary lab results
and they sent them back to confirm what
they had gotten. I don’t know whether
they got something or whether they
didn’t get something.” |
